CentOS是一種自由的,企業級的Linux操作系統。許多公司都使用CentOS來運行Oracle數據庫。Oracle SQL是一個強大的工具,經常被用來管理和查詢這些數據庫。在這篇文章中,我們將探討CentOS,Oracle和SQL之間的關系。
在CentOS上使用Oracle SQL是非常常見的。例如,在一個大型電子商務網站上,可能會有數十個管理系統和數百個數據庫。使用Oracle SQL可以幫助管理這些數據庫并快速查詢相關信息。例如,管理員想要查找那些購買量最高的商品,就可以使用Oracle SQL進行查詢,獲得準確和快速的結果。
SELECT product.name, sum(purchase.quantity) AS total_quantity FROM product JOIN purchase ON product.id = purchase.product_id GROUP BY product.name ORDER BY total_quantity DESC;
該查詢會返回一個結果集,顯示出所有購買量最高的商品。
在CentOS上安裝Oracle SQL也是非常簡單的。首先,需要安裝Oracle客戶端。然后,可以在終端中使用sqlplus命令來連接到數據庫。以下是一個樣例連接字符串:
sqlplus username/password@database
其中,“username”和“password”是登錄憑據,“database”是要連接的數據庫名。連接成功后,就可以開始使用Oracle SQL進行查詢和管理數據庫了。
Oracle SQL有很多強大的功能。例如,可以使用存儲過程來自動執行任務。例如,在一個大型電子商務網站上,每天早上需要更新最新的銷售數據。可以使用存儲過程來自動執行這個任務。以下是一個簡單的存儲過程:
CREATE OR REPLACE PROCEDURE update_sales_data AS BEGIN INSERT INTO sales_data (date, total_sales) SELECT CURRENT_DATE, SUM(total_amount) FROM orders; END; /
該存儲過程會在每天的凌晨自動執行,將當日的銷售數據更新到數據庫中。
總之,在CentOS上使用Oracle SQL可以非常方便地管理和查詢數據庫。無論是大型企業還是小型公司,都可以受益于這個強大的工具。如果你正在使用CentOS,并且需要管理或查詢Oracle數據庫,那么Oracle SQL是一個不錯的選擇。